Magoosh is our top choice because it includes an extensive set of online study resources, an impressive 50-point score improvement guarantee, and a price point that’s far below top competitors. While you don’t get as many resources as some big-name test prep companies, the value here is tough to beat.
The Premium version is best for most self-study students and costs $249 for one year of access. Study content in the premium package includes all four GMAT sections with at least two practice tests, more than 340 video lessons, and 1,300 practice questions. Magoosh includes a score predictor, which helps you know if you need to study harder or if you’re on track for your target score.
A version that includes only the math and integrated reasoning sections is available for $219, or you can upgrade to a course that offers 16 hours of live classes in small groups for $599. While it would be nice to see more than two practice exams guaranteed, Magoosh customers get 40% off official GMAT practice exams if you care to add those on.

When studying for any exam, official prep materials from the exam’s creator are a great way to get a feel for the actual exam experience. We like that you get that for free from the GMAT Official Starter Kit at MBA.com.
After signing up, you get free, unlimited access to two full-length practice exams, 90 practice questions, and time-management reports to help you understand where you need to focus most during the real exam. The practice tests simulate the test-taking experience, so they are a good way to start your exam prep with an idea of what lies ahead.
While it is free, the resources are limited, and you’ll likely need an additional, paid preparation course to do well on the GMAT. More practice exams are available for purchase from MBA.com, but there’s little reason to skip this free option to improve your GMAT skills.

Kaplan is a huge test prep company, and we picked it as the best online GMAT prep course because of its depth of resources and various course-taking options. You can choose between a self-paced course or an instructor-led experience with live teaching. You get access to six full practice exams no matter if you do self-paced or with an instructor.
Students have access to many additional resources and features. Resources include foundations of GMAT guides, a seven-hour math workshop, a test simulation booklet, and more.
The self-paced course costs $999. The more expensive live online version costs $1,599 and includes sessions in an online classroom where you can ask questions to a team of teachers. There are other options as well from Kaplan including in-person instruction. While it’s one of the more expensive courses, the extensive resources included may make it worth the cost.

The Princeton Review is a major exam prep company covering many more courses than the GMAT, and its GMAT courses stand out as a top choice for in-person exam prep. While it is a bit pricier than the GMAT Fundamentals course, the GMAT 700+ course, which guarantees you a score of 700 or higher if you start with a score of at least 620, is likely the best choice for most.
The GMAT 700+ course includes 47 hours of instruction. There are 27 hours of core course classroom instruction plus at least 10 hours of focused instruction on advanced GMAT questions and at least 10 hours of verbal and math explanation sessions. In addition, students get other resources including the official GMAT guidebook bundle which includes over 4,480 practice questions. The course also has 10 computer generated, adaptive practices tests.
These courses are not cheap, but you get what you pay for. The Fundamentals course has a regular prices of $1,399, while the GMAT 700+ course is priced at $1,999. There's also a self-guided option for $799. However, the courses are frequently on sale. Reasonably sized, in-person classes can be a major asset in preparing for the GMAT and entering into your preferred MBA program.

TestMasters offers a self-guided online course, in-person classroom course, and private one-on-one course instruction. The biggest unique feature is a score improvement guarantee of 100+ points, which is the biggest guarantee of any course reviewed.
However you decide to proceed with TestMasters, all courses include 12 class sessions plus an additional 1,200+ pages of study materials and a copy of The Official Guide for GMAT Review. The biggest downside is the online experience, which lags behind competitors. But while the design isn’t stellar, the content is solid.
You can take the online-only version for $899, the in-person classroom course for $999, or private one-on-one teaching for $2,999. The private one-on-one course is a bit pricey, but it could be the right choice for students who do best with personal attention.

PrepScholar is our top option for GMAT prep on a budget, as it offers courses starting at just $99. That’s less than 5% of what you’ll pay with some of the most expensive options. While there’s an option under $100, most students will do best with the $399 Completely Customized Online GMAT Prep course. It includes a 60-point score improvement guarantee.
The $399 version includes four months of access to more than 100 hours of content, 1,000+ practice questions, and a diagnostic exam. Lessons focus on GMAT skills, GMAT strategy, and the content that makes up each of the four exam sections.
For an additional cost, you can add a tutoring package. Tutoring isn’t the cheapest around, starting at $799 for four hours (about $200 per hour), but for those who feel confident learning at their own pace, the self-guided online courses are very affordable compared to the competition.

What Is the GMAT?
The GMAT is the Graduate Management Admissions Test. This test is the standard entrance exam for Masters in Business Administration (MBA) programs worldwide. The GMAT is a computer-based test including multiple-choice questions and an essay section. GMAT scores range from 200 to 800, with an average score of around 575. Every university has different MBA admission requirements, so you should check your desired programs for typical undergraduate grades and GMAT scores for admission.

How Much Do GMAT Prep Courses Cost?
While there are free GMAT preparation resources available, most GMAT-bound individuals would likely benefit from a paid GMAT prep course. Among the courses we reviewed, costs ranged from $69 for basic, self-guided online programs to around $3,000 for a one-on-one, personalized course experience. Quality courses start at about $250 for online, self-guided lessons and materials. Many course providers offer additional tutoring and one-on-one instruction for an additional cost.
